reading a bit further in that article>>However, Redditor and fellow Rivian R1T owner Earlgr3yh0t was also rear-ended a few months back, except their rear quarter panel had a basketball-sized dent just below the taillight. They took the R1T to a certified Rivian body shop who said the entire rear quarter panel, as well as some tailgate internals, needed replacing. The total cost of replacing an entire body panel and some tailgate bits was reportedly just over $14,000. So a $42,000 rear bumper replacement seems exorbitant, but Apfelstadt says he's happy with his truck.

I would call the body shop that took the back of the whole dam truck apart "pirates" for lack of a far worse word. I don't believe the intention of Rivian was to strip down the entire rear body of the truck. And $14K was a rip off too....UNLESS the rear drive unit, air lift suspension and a myriad of other high tech parts were severely damaged. Just another article to put down EV's.
